We spoke to Martin Murray of Dunnet Bay Distillers, makers of the fantastic range of Rock Rose Gins. Back in August 2014, husband and wife team, Martin and his wife Claire founded Dunnet Bay Distillery at the spectacular bay of Dunnet in the far North of Scotland.  

The couple are passionate about handcrafting spirits that celebrate the heritage and provenance of their home county of Caithness and pride themselves on using local hand-foraged botanicals alongside exotic botanicals from around the world.

We love that even the famous Rock Rose Perfect Serve of rosemary and orange peel was a collaboration – Martin preferring Rosemary and Claire preferring a twist of orange. Together, they really work!


· How did you meet?

It was the last day of high school and we met at a party celebrating it.  We were in the same year at high school, but our paths hadn’t crossed until that day.  That was nearly 20 years ago and I can’t think where the time has gone since then!

· How did you begin your Scottish Gin journey together?

I don’t know when the actual Scottish Gin journey seed was planted.  I think we’d decided a long time ago that we had complementary skills and that working together might be fun.

We started dreaming of a distillery when I was worked offshore on the Elgin platform, around 2009.  It took a long time and lots of planning, but we got there and we are delighted with how the journey is going.

· What’s the best thing about working together?

We can approve each other’s leave requests! I think the best thing is seeing something that we both put our heart into working out well. When we started planning Rock Rose, Claire was in charge of the design of the bottle and I worked on the recipe development.  It was great seeing the positive feedback on both and how it has grown since.
